The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Henry Fowler, born in 1850 in Croydon, Surrey, consisted of 3 members. Henry was the head of the household, married to Harriet Fowler, born in 1850 in Rugby, Warwickshire, England. They had 1 child; Henry W, born 1880 in Shoreditch, Middlesex, England.
